Young Christian Students

In a time littered with evolving uncertainty, faith remains our guide to solace, to unity. Young Christian Students (YCS) has been a central piece of instilling that faith in action, in the hopes that it will ripple through our school community and contribute to alleviating the pressures of this daunting time. As a segment of a larger Catholic youth movement that is completely student-based, we hope to create a space devoted to the needs of our peers and the wider Christian circle. YCS continues to embody the significance of student leadership and offers an outlet for student initiative and expression. It is a reflection of the inclusive nature that lies at the heart of our school, hence we heavily prioritise not only supporting but empowering student voice, putting it forth to inspire creative and sustainable growth. 

Our most recent initiative is based on stress management, both within ourselves and the wider school community. Being students on the senior campus, our studies are crucial at this stage and it is easy to neglect oneself and grow consumed with the demands of our final years of school. Possessing the skills required to manage stress effectively is significant, especially in the sense that it is long lasting and will be applicable through every stage of life, it will condition us as young adults to face our futures unbound and to the best of our abilities. 

Currently, we are working in partnership with other YCS teams in neighbouring schools, and hope to bring this conversation to light by extending our reach to Catholic communities beyond our own. We aim to produce a series of stress management videos, which contain diverse methods of approaching stress at various stages. Managing stress is a process that is unique to the individual, but we hope our videos can serve as a reference point to set the process in motion or inspire it further. These are intensely uncertain and trying times, hence the videos produced will not only aid us all in managing stress as it arises, but they will also provide the opportunity to grow both individually and collectively through the strength of one another.
